MySQL运维宝典:DBA高效管理实战指南

MySQL作为广泛使用的开源关系型数据库,其稳定性和性能直接影响业务系统的运行。对于DBA而言,掌握高效的运维方法至关重要。

日常监控是保障MySQL稳定运行的基础。通过监控工具如Prometheus、Zabbix或自带的Performance Schema,可以实时了解数据库的连接数、慢查询、锁等待等关键指标。

数据备份与恢复策略是DBA必须重视的环节。定期全量备份结合增量日志备份,能够在数据丢失时快速恢复。同时,测试恢复流程也是确保备份有效性的关键步骤。

查询优化是提升数据库性能的核心手段。分析慢查询日志,合理使用索引,避免全表扫描,能够显著提高响应速度。•调整配置参数如缓冲池大小、连接数限制等,也能改善整体性能。

AI绘图结果,仅供参考

高可用架构设计能有效降低单点故障风险。主从复制、MHA、Galera Cluster等方案可根据业务需求灵活选择,确保数据的持续可用性。

安全管理同样不可忽视。设置强密码策略、限制访问权限、定期更新补丁,都是防止数据泄露和攻击的重要措施。

持续学习和实践是提升运维能力的关键。关注官方文档、参与社区交流、积累实战经验,能让DBA在面对复杂问题时更加从容。

dawei

【声明】:蚌埠站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。